pow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Значение ,возвращаемое функцией типа string
12 сообщений из 12, страница 1 из 1
Значение ,возвращаемое функцией типа string
    #35999775
Денис24
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Есть моя функция
Код: plaintext
1.
2.
3.
4.
Public Function StrSql() As String
.
.
.
Возвращаемое значение длинной 255 символов.А формируется в ней строка длинее.
Как решить?
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999784
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а для чего это тебе?
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999788
Фотография Игорь Горбонос
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
> Автор: Денис24
> Возвращаемое значение длинной 255 символов.А формируется в ней строка длинее.
> Как решить?

Ничего не понял
Нужно вернуть только 255 символов? StrSql = Left(stroka, 255)
Или проблема в том, что формируемая строка длиннее 255 символов и нужна вся строка?
тогда пересматривай логику работы программы


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999822
Денис24
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
В функции формируется строка > 255,а возвращает именно 255.
Это ограничение vb?
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999835
Денис24
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Konst_One,

формирую строку sql-запроса.
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999852
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Денис24В функции формируется строка > 255,а возвращает именно 255.
Это ограничение vb?

не может такого быть, код в студию
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999864
Фотография Игорь Горбонос
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
> Автор: Денис24
> В функции формируется строка > 255,а возвращает именно 255.
> Это ограничение vb?

Это у тебя стоит объявление переменной такое
Код: plaintext
Dim sSql As String *  255 



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999901
Денис24
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
Public Function StrSql() As String
 
StrSql = "select to_char(date_call,'dd/mm/yyyy') as date_call,to_char(date_call,'hh:mi') as time_call,ext ,co ,num ,duration,nvl(duration_sec,0)as duration_sec,IO   from ats where  " & _
" to_char(date_call,'hh') between " & Hour(DTPickerTimeBeg.Value) & " and " & Hour(DTPickerTimeEnd.Value) & " and " & _
" trunc(date_call) between  '" & DTPickerBegin.Value & "'  and  '" & DTPickerEnd.Value
.
.
.
End Function

Вызов этой функции
rs_help.Open Str_Sql_time, , adOpenStatic, adLockReadOnly, adCmdText 
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999907
Денис24
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Денис24,

rs_help.Open StrSq, , adOpenStatic, adLockReadOnly, adCmdText
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999914
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
у тебя ошибка в строке запроса. выведи его Debug.print и сам поймешь
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#35999996
Денис24
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Konst_One,

точно!прорустил кавычку.Я аж испугался :)
...
Рейтинг: 0 / 0
Значение ,возвращаемое функцией типа string
    #36000531
Мамба
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Та же самая проблема, из вышенаписанного ничего не ясно. :( Можно на пальцах как-нибудь объяснить...
...
Рейтинг: 0 / 0
12 сообщений из 12, страница 1 из 1
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Значение ,возвращаемое функцией типа string
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]